Akureyri, northern Iceland's largest city and its capital of the North, sits at the head of Iceland's longest fjord, ringed by mountains. It has heart-shaped red traffic lights, a hillside church and one of the world's northernmost botanical gardens. It is the gateway to Godafoss waterfall, the steaming Myvatn volcanic lake and whale-watching Husavik, while winters bring the aurora.

Akureyri is Iceland's northern capital, at the end of the longest fjord, Eyjafjörður, a hub for the northern ring road. Summer (Jun-Aug) has long days, great for Goðafoss, the Mývatn geothermal area (pseudocraters, mud pots, Mývatn Nature Baths) and Húsavík whale watching; autumn-winter (Sep-Mar) in the north is excellent for aurora chasing. The north is colder with winter snow — keep warm and be cautious on winter roads. About 5 hours' drive from Reykjavík or a 45-minute flight.
